  • Calculation formula for photovoltaic bracket spacing

    Calculation formula for photovoltaic bracket spacing

    Estimate the ideal spacing between rows of solar panels to minimize shading and maximize efficiency based on latitude, tilt, and panel height. Formula: Spacing = Height / tan (Solar Altitude).

  • What is the design latitude of the photovoltaic bracket

    What is the design latitude of the photovoltaic bracket

    The optimal solar panel tilt angle equals your latitude, facing true south (Northern Hemisphere) or true north (Southern Hemisphere). At 40° latitude (New York), set panels to 40° tilt.
